Ticket: DEDUP-412 — Connection failures during customer record dedup

The Larkspur dedup job started failing overnight with pool exhaustion errors. It merges duplicate customer records in batches of 500, but the batch worker isn't releasing connections after a merge conflict, so the pool drains within twenty minutes. Proposed fix: wrap merges in a try/finally release and cap retries at three. For the sync, reproduce against staging using the connection string below.

primary connection of bagep-kaweg = clickhouse://rusdor_svc:3TXlgH7O8DuUYI@db-ae3f.zarqelgrid.internal:5432/zordor

Welcome to the Shelfwright stack! The catalogue import job pulls nightly MARC exports from the Brindlemoor consortium and shoves them through the normalizer before anything touches the live index. It's mostly hands-off, but the upload step to the staging bucket is authenticated, so don't skip that part when you rebuild the runner. Rotation happens quarterly — check the runbook if it's stale. The current deploy key is listed directly below.

deploy key for kajof-fajop: bky6_gDHw9Q

# Load-test constants for the Cartwheel checkout flow.
# These values drive synthetic traffic against the staging payment
# gateway only; production credentials are never loaded by this module.
# Reviewers should confirm the ramp rate stays below the fraud-detection
# threshold agreed with the Pelora team. The tuning constants are
# defined below.

tuning constants:
QUOTAS = {
    "druwyn": 5,
    "holix": 5,
    "zorath": 5,
    "holwyn": 10,
}